Tulsa Splits Games in Day Two of TXST Tournament

2/17/2024 7:56:00 PM | Softball

SAN MARCOS, Texas – The University of Tulsa softball team started the day with a narrow 3-2 loss to Texas Tech before bouncing back to knock off Texas State 3-1 in day two action of the TXST Tournament.
 
The Hurricane (5-3, 0-0 AAC) is 3-1 on the weekend after recording an 11-5 win over Northern Colorado and a 5-2 victory over Texas State in the weekend's first games on Friday. Texas Tech finished the day 6-2 after nabbing a second win over Texas State. The Bobcats bring a 7-5 record into the final day of the competition.  
 
Both of Tulsa's games on Saturday featured good defense and pitching, with no runs until the sixth inning of game one, and the fourth of the second game. Anneca Anderson (2-0) performed well in her second week of collegiate action, going the distance in the win over Texas State. She struck out eight and allowed just one run on four hits.
 
Maura Moore (2-2) also put in a strong shift with a difficult sixth inning blemishing an otherwise stellar outing. Three of the five hits she allowed, and all three runs, occurred in the sixth. Kylee Nash came in to pitch the final two innings, allowing no hits and striking out a pair.
 
Haley Morgan, MacKenzie Denson, Imani Edwards and Maci Cole all had multiple hits on the day. Edwards, Kailyn Bearpaw, Celeste Wood, Claira Skaggs and Abby Jones each recorded an RBI during the day.
 
GAME 1 – TEXAS TECH 3, TULSA 2
It was a pitcher's dual in the Saturday opener, with neither team able to get much going off the opposing starter. Texas Tech recorded the first hit in the game in the third inning after going down in order in the first two. For the Hurricane, TU didn't get its first hit until an Imani Edwards single in the fourth.
 
Maura Moore struck out five batters in the opening four innings while allowing just two hits through five. Texas Tech's Maddy Wright would go the distance, allowing five hits and two runs while striking out four.
 
The Red Raiders broke the deadlock in the sixth. Consecutive singles and a walked batter loaded the bases with nobody out. Texas Tech then cleared the bases with a three-run double, ending Moore's morning. She departed with three runs, all earned, five hits and five strikeouts in her five innings of work. Kylee Nash entered the circle to try to get out of the inning with no further damage. Tech loaded the bags again with one out, but Claira Skaggs collected a ground ball and went home with the throw to stop another run from scoring. A fly out ended the threat.
 
Haley Morgan got Tulsa started in the bottom of the frame with a single up the middle. MacKenzie Denson reached on an error from the third baseman, which allowed her to move up to second and Morgan to third. After a ground out, Kailyn Bearpaw delivered a big single to right, scoring Morgan and putting Denson on third. Unfortunately, a twin-killing ended Tulsa's opportunity to cut further into the lead.
 
After Nash set the Red Raiders down in order in the seventh, the Hurricane had one last chance. A one-out Maci Cole double gave Tulsa some life, which was emboldened as Celeste Wood followed with a double of her own to make it 3-2. Nash moved her to third on a ground out and Morgan was intentionally walked, bringing up Denson. She hit a hard liner, but it was snagged by the third baseman to end the game.

GAME 2 – TULSA 3, TEXAS STATE 2
Just like in game one, runs were at a premium in Tulsa's afternoon game. The Bobcats threatened in the bottom of the opening inning, getting runners on second and third with nobody out. But freshman Anneca Anderson got the next three runners out with no damage done.
 
The hosts got another single in the third, but Tulsa was the first to put a tally in the runs section with a big fourth inning. Haley Morgan got Tulsa's first hit of the afternoon, followed swifty by an infield single from MacKenzie Denson. Imani Edwards made it three straight singles, scoring Morgan from second to put Tulsa up 1-0.
 
After an out was recorded, Claira Skaggs singled down the line in right to score Denson. Abby Jones grounded into a fielder's choice, which allowed Edwards to score and put Tulsa up 3-0.
 
That was all Anderson would need. The pitcher struck out three straight Bobcats in the bottom of the fourth to strand two. Texas State got on the board in the fifth, taking advantage of a Tulsa error after a single. After getting through the fifth, Anderson had relatively clean innings in the sixth and seventh, allowing one base runner in each but no hits.
 
Anderson tossed seven complete innings with only one run on four hits with three walks and eight batters struck out.
